Having an almost-3-year-old in the house provides for daily entertainment (both in the comedy and drama departments).  My daughter's vocabulary is pretty good, but sometimes she just doesn't get the word right.  My husband and I have fun around here trying to figure out some of the strange words, and when we do, we seem to start using them ourselves!  I created this page about some of my favorite funny things that she says: Pams-shoo and Pail-nolish (shampoo and nailpolish).


When I started this page, since the photos were of different events in different settings, I needed to bring them together somehow.  I started thinking about "shampoo" and baths, so I decided to use the blue paper in the Sweet Tooth collection to represent bubbles.  And when I think of nailpolish, I think of girly things and pink, so the floral papers in this line were perfect, too!  I combined both of these elements inspired by my photos (circles and flowers) to create the basis of my page.



I cut the letters and ampersand on my Cricut and stitched through them with some pink thread.  A little fussy cutting of of some of the diamond patterned paper and the flowers, and I created a fun and memorable page.


Supplies: all papers from Sweet Tooth Collection- Bubble Gum (1552), Cherry Cordial (1553), Gum Drop (1555), Sprinkles (1560), Sugar Cookie (1561), Sweet Tart (1562).  Other: Die Cutting Machine (Cricut), Stickles (Ranger), Smooch Inks (Clearsnap).
